Skip to content

Instantly share code, notes, and snippets.

@noginn
Created December 28, 2012 10:31
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save noginn/4396702 to your computer and use it in GitHub Desktop.
Save noginn/4396702 to your computer and use it in GitHub Desktop.
Using array_map with array_keys
<?php
$headers = array(
'X-PAYPAL-APPLICATION-ID' => 'APP-1234567890',
'X-PAYPAL-REQUEST-DATA-FORMAT' => 'NV',
'X-PAYPAL-RESPONSE-DATA-FORMAT' => 'NV'
);
$headerStrings = array_map(function ($key, $value) {
return $key . ': ' . $value;
}, array_keys($headers), $headers);
// $headerStrings => array(
// 'X-PAYPAL-APPLICATION-ID: APP-1234567890',
// 'X-PAYPAL-REQUEST-DATA-FORMAT: NV',
// 'X-PAYPAL-RESPONSE-DATA-FORMAT: NV'
// )
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ment